Yes, it could be reduced, although that has never happened.

On a very related note (but not exactly the same), the elimination of PG30 will have the effect of lowering the pay for all pay grades, in a certain sense.

Right now, PG45 is 5.75 over the base (PG30), but only 5.25 above PG35. If the new base goes from 12 to 13 at the same time (or after) PG30 is eliminated, then PG35 will go from 12.50 to 13, meaning PG45 will go from 17.75 to 18.25.

In summary, the increase from 12 to 13 is only $.50 for a lot of people.
 
Can the base for a pay grade be adjusted downwards? I know they won’t reduce someone’s pay but can they reduce the starting pay for a given paygrade?

They probably can but it is extremely unlikely to happen because reducing starting pay makes Target less competitive during hiring time. Usually, either starting pay stays the same or it goes up in order to compete with other places who pay similar or more.
